WebJan 24, 2024 · Aerophagia can be caused by anything that prompts you to swallow air. It is normal for aerophagia to occur when swallowing saliva, drinking, or eating. Increased amounts of air swallowing can be caused by CPAP therapy and may also occur for other reasons, including: Eating or drinking quickly. Chewing gum. Treating OSA with CPAP therapy has been found to reduce daytime sleepiness and increase their alertness. Even one night of CPAP use can lead to improved attention the next day. Some people with OSA might have residual sleepiness even after treatment with CPAP therapy. might not reduce sleepiness.
